Bake it in a thoroughly preheated oven, ideally on a lower rack, to help the base crisp up. A preheated baking tray or pizza stone can improve the result further.
Reheat slices in a covered skillet over low to medium heat so the base crisps while the cheese melts. A microwave is quick, but it often leaves the crust soft.
Cooked or opened pizza generally keeps for 3 to 4 days in an airtight container in the refrigerator. Do not leave it at room temperature for more than two hours, and reheat it until piping hot.
Yes, individual slices can be wrapped well and frozen. For the best texture, use within 1 to 2 months and reheat straight from frozen in the oven or a skillet.
A large green salad with a light dressing adds volume and vegetables without making the meal much heavier. Water or unsweetened drinks are generally a better match than sugary soft drinks.
Salami is often milder and less spicy, while pepperoni typically has a stronger paprika and chilli flavour. Both are processed meats, so the choice is mainly about taste and checking the product's salt content.
It may feel heavy immediately before exercise because the cheese and salami can slow digestion. If you choose it, having it around 2 to 3 hours before training is usually more comfortable than eating it just before.
No. Weight change depends primarily on overall long-term energy intake and activity, not the clock alone. However, a large late meal may worsen reflux, indigestion, or sleep in some people.
It is a processed food, and processed meats such as salami are commonly higher in salt and saturated fat. It can fit occasionally, but meals based more often on vegetables and minimally processed foods are a healthier routine.
People with gluten or dairy allergies should avoid it. Those with lactose intolerance, coeliac disease, high blood pressure, reflux, or advice to limit processed meat should check ingredients carefully and keep portions moderate.
